The Technical Architecture Powering Precision
Gaode's superiority in China's mapping sector stems from its multi-layered data infrastructure:
- Real-time traffic processing: Aggregates anonymized movement data from 700 million devices with AI-powered prediction models that update road conditions every 30 seconds
- 3D city modeling: Detailed building meshes and elevation data for 368 Chinese cities enable accurate AR navigation and flyover visualization
- Hybrid positioning: Combines GPS, GLONASS, BeiDou satellite signals with 50 million WiFi fingerprint points and Bluetooth beacons for indoor-outdoor continuity

Developer Tools Creating Location-Aware Applications
Gaode's open platform offers robust APIs that power location intelligence across industries:
- Geocoding API: Converts Chinese addresses to coordinates with 99.9% accuracy even for complex rural addresses
- Matrix Routing API: Calculates optimal routes between multiple points simultaneously for logistics optimization
- Indoor Maps SDK: Enables precise indoor navigation in airports and shopping malls with floor-level accuracy

Why Gaode Wins in China's Competitive Map Space
Three key differentiators explain Gaode's market leadership:
- Regulatory alignment: As one of only two licensed mapping providers, Gaode complies with China's surveying laws while competitors face API restrictions
- Hyper-localization: Understanding that "East 3rd Ring Road" means nothing without district context in Beijing's concentric layout
- Alibaba ecosystem integration: Deep links with Alipay, Taobao, and Fliggy create seamless "map-to-purchase" user journeys
Implementing Gaode APIs: Best Practices
For developers integrating location services:
- Cache POI data intelligently—Gaode updates 15% of business listings monthly
- Use hybrid coordinate systems—GCJ-02 for display while storing WGS-84 for analysis
- Implement fallback mechanisms—China's complex urban canyons sometimes require WiFi positioning
